B1502

Lamp Turn Signal Left Circuit Short To Ground

What This Actually Means

In plain language — no jargon

The left turn signal circuit is detecting a short to ground, meaning electricity is taking an unintended path directly to ground instead of flowing through the bulb properly. It's like water escaping from a leak in a pipe before reaching the faucet.

Symptoms You May Notice

3 known symptoms for this code
Left turn signal does not illuminate or blinks erratically
Dashboard turn signal indicator lamp may flash rapidly or not work
Possible blown fuse related to turn signal circuit

How Your ECU Detects This

Technical sensor logic and voltage thresholds

The body control module monitors the voltage and current draw of the left turn signal circuit. It expects a specific current range when the signal is activated; a short to ground causes excessive current draw or voltage drop below threshold, triggering the fault code.

Voltage & Parameter Thresholds

ParameterNormal RangeFault Condition
Turn Signal Circuit Current 0.5-3.0 amps (depending on bulb type) >5.0 amps or <0.2 amps (short to ground detection)
Circuit Voltage 11-14 volts when signal active <2 volts (indicates short path)

Diagnostic & DIY Fix Guide

Check these in order — from cheapest to most complex
1
Turn signal fuse
Locate and replace the blown left turn signal fuse in the fuse panel with the same amperage rating.
2
Turn signal bulb
Remove and inspect the left front/rear turn signal bulb for corrosion or damage, then replace if faulty.
3
Wiring harness and connectors
Inspect the left turn signal wiring for pinched, melted, or exposed insulation causing the short, and repair or replace as needed.

How to Clear Code B1502

What happens after you fix the fault

Once the fault is repaired, B1502 can be cleared using any OBD-II scanner. Connect the scanner, navigate to "Clear Codes" or "Erase DTCs," and confirm. The check engine light turns off immediately.

The code will return if the root cause was not actually fixed. The ECM re-detects the fault within 1–3 drive cycles and sets the code again.
